Nit picky, however, we are de-worming. Unless there is pasture mgmt
one can de-worm daily & not make any difference. Manure needs to be
dealt with in pastures, stalls, whatever. Very nice if one can rotate
pastures.

One needs to remember horses constantly re-infect themselves & total
removal of parasites is almost as bad as a pandemic of parasites.
